One person is in the hospital after an accident in Putnam County Monday evening.
Dispatchers say the accident happened on Poca River Road, in Poca, around 5 p.m. Monday.
We are told the driver of the vehicle lost control and wrecked.
A total of three people were in the car when it crashed. We are told one of them was thrown from the vehicle.
